How to get from Pickering to Orangeville by bus?

By bus

To get from Pickering to Orangeville in Toronto, you’ll need to take 3 bus lines: take the 90 bus from Pickering Station Go Rail station to Union Station Bus Terminal station. Next, you’ll have to switch to the 31 bus and finally take the 37 bus from Main St. N. @ Vodden St. E. station to Hwy. 10 @ Buena Vista Dr. station. The total trip duration for this route is approximately 3 hr 48 min. The ride fare is CA$15.51.
